Inbound Interface: The Data that is being brought in to oracle application from markets 
Eg: Purchase Requisitions (From Market-->Oracle)

Out Bound Interface: The data that is being sent to markets from oracle application.
Eg: Purchase Order(From Oracle-->Market)

Here, Markets are nothing but legacy systems which are running with different software.

Inbound interface: We load the data which we got from the legacy systems.

Outbound interface : We extract the data for legacy systems.
